How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Danube?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Danube Studio Apartments | $1,005 | $745 | $1,175 |
| Danube 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,063 | $525 | $1,605 |
| Danube 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,326 | $625 | $1,785 |
| Danube 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,642 | $1,150 | $2,300 |
| Danube 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,350 | $1,350 | $1,350 |
